开发工具 > 

博福特密码转换_博福特密码加密解密

博福特密码(Beaufort Cipher),是一种类似于维吉尼亚密码的替代密码,不同之处在于密码的字符编码方式略有不同。
例如,明文的第一个字母为I,则先在表格中找到第I列,由于密钥的第一个字母为K,于是I列从上往下找到K行,第K行对应I列的字母C,便是密文的第一个字母。以此类推可以得到密文。
如下密钥为KEYS时的加密例子:
明文:ILOVEBEAUFORTCIPHER
密钥:KEYSKEYSKEYSKEYSKEY
密文:CTKXGDUSQZKBRCQDDAH

博福特密码表: